/* CSS Document */
body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,button,input,textarea,th,td{margin:0;padding:0;}
body{ padding:0; margin:0;  font:normal 12px/180% "宋体"; color:#333;text-align:center; background:#f1f8fe}
div { margin:0 auto;text-align:left;font:normal 12px/180% "宋体";}
li,p {font:normal 12px/180% "宋体"; text-align:left;}
a{color:#333;}
a:link,a:visited{text-decoration:none}
a:hover{text-decoration:underline}
img{ border:none}
ol,ul,li{list-style:none;} 
/*clear*/
.clear{ clear:both}
.clearfix:after{display:block;clear:both;content:".";visibility:hidden; height:0}
/*other*/
.marg_top10{ margin-top:10px;}
.marg_bt10{ margin-bottom:10px;}
.margin10{ margin:10px auto}
.width980{ width:980px;}
h1,h1 a{font:normal 12px/28px "宋体"; text-align:right;color:#cb010a;}
h1 b{font-size:14px;font-weight:bold; float:left;}
h2{border-bottom:1px solid #cb010a; overflow:hidden;height:25px;clear:both;}
h2,h2 a{font:normal 12px/28px "宋体"; text-align:right;color:#cb010a;}
h2 b{ background:url(images/tit.gif) no-repeat; width:92px; text-align:center;line-height:24px;}
h2 b,h2 b a{font-size:14px;font-weight:bold; float:left;color:#fff;}
h3{background:url(images/tit2.gif) no-repeat ;line-height:32px;height:32px; width:946px; padding:0 10px; text-align:right;color:#fff;}
h3,h3 a{font:normal 12px/32px "宋体";color:#efb3b2;}
h3 b{ float:left;color:#fff;font-size:14px;}
.line{background:url(images/line.gif) repeat-x ;line-height:1px;height:1px; overflow:hidden;}
.line1{background:url(images/line1.gif) repeat-x ;line-height:1px;height:1px;width:95%;}
.list_14 li{ background:url(images/dot.gif) no-repeat center left; padding-left:8px;font-size:14px;}
.list_12 li{ background:url(images/dot.gif) no-repeat center left;padding-left:8px;line-height:24px;}
a.more{color:#cc3333}
#copyright{clear:both;padding:25px 0;text-align:center}
.space{height:10px;background:#fff;line-height:10px;clear:both;border-top:1px solid #ccc; overflow:hidden;}
.space1{height:10px;line-height:10px;clear:both; overflow:hidden; background:url(images/line1.gif) no-repeat left;}
.space2{border-top:1px solid #dceffe;border-bottom:1px solid #dceffe;height:8px;background:#fff; overflow:hidden;clear:both;}


.center{text-align:center}
.ad{clear:both;text-align:center;}
.ad img{border:1px solid #ccc;}
.ad1{background:#fff;}
.ad1 img{border:1px solid #ccc;margin:7px 0;}
.content{ background:#fff; overflow:hidden;}
i,i a,em,em a{ font-style:normal;}

.top{border:1px solid #b6c6df;line-height:35px;height:35px; background:url(images/topbg.gif) repeat-x; text-align:right;}
.top img{ float:left;}
.top a{margin:0 10px;}
.nav{ background:url(images/navbg.gif) repeat-x;line-height:39px;color:#fff;font-weight:bold; text-align:center;font-size:14px;}
.nav a{margin:0 10px;color:#fff;}

.p1_content{ background:url(images/bg.gif);overflow:hidden;border-top:6px solid #fff; width:980px;}
.p1_left{margin:0 0 0 5px; float:left;width:670px; overflow:hidden; display:inline;}
.p1_a{width:650px;border-top:1px solid #ccc; overflow:hidden;padding:9px; background:#fff;}
.p1_a span{ float:left; display:block; width:300px;margin:0 10px 0 0;}
.p1_a ul{ float:right; width:325px;}
.p1_a ul li{line-height:24px;}
.p1_a h1{margin:0 10px; float:right; width:310px;}
.p1_b{ float:left;width:320px; padding:5px;border-top:1px solid #ccc; display:inline; overflow:hidden;}
.p1_b ul{clear:both;margin:10px 10px 5px 10px;}
.p1_b h2{margin:0 5px;}
.p1_c{ float:right;}
.p1_right{ float:right;width:289px;margin-right:5px;border-top:1px solid #dceffe;display:inline;}
.p1_right h2{margin:5px;}
.p1_right ul{clear:both;margin:10px;}
.list_img li{ background:url(images/ico.gif) no-repeat left center; padding-left:17px;line-height:24px;}

.p2_content{background:#fff; overflow:hidden; width:966px;border:1px solid #ccc; padding:1px;}
.p2_content span{ margin:10px; display:block; float:left;display:inline;line-height:26px; text-align:center;}
.p2_content span i{color:#cccccc;font-size:12px;}
.p3_content{ background:url(images/bg.gif);overflow:hidden; width:980px;}
.p3_content .p1_b{overflow:hidden;}
.p3_right{float:right;width:290px;margin-right:5px;display:inline;}
.p4_content span{ text-align:center;margin:10px 0 0 11px;line-height:26px;}
.link{border:1px solid #ccc;margin:10px 4px; padding:10px;}
.link a{margin:0 5px;}
.copyright{ text-align:center; padding:20px 0;}

.ej_content{ background:url(images/bg1.gif);width:970px; overflow:hidden;margin-top:5px;}
.ej_left{width:670px;float:left;}
.ej_left1{width:303px;padding:5px;float:left;}
.ej_left1 span{ display:block; overflow:hidden;}
.ej_left ul{margin:10px 5px;}
.ej_path{line-height:30px;height:30px; background:#fff; border-bottom:1px solid #ccc; padding:0 10px;}
.ej_center{ float:right; width:337px; padding:0 10px;}
.ej_center ul li,.ej_center ul li a{color:#333;}
.ej_center span{color:#666; text-align:center; display:block;height:33px;line-height:33px;}
.list_14 li.one{background:none;font-size:12px;}
.list_14 li.one a{color:#666;}
.ej_right{ float:right;width:290px;border-top:1px solid #dceffe;display:inline;}
.ej_right h2{margin:5px;}
.ej_right ul{clear:both;margin:10px;}

